SETTLEMENT AGREEMENT

THIS SETTLEMENT AGREEMENT is made on 4 July 2008:

BETWEEN:

 

(1) JOKI Holding AG, a company constituted under Swiss Law, registered with the commercial register of Kanton Zug under firm no. CH-020.3.005.028-9, with its seat in Zug and business address at Neugasse 7, 6300 Zug, Switzerland (“JOKI”);

 

(2) Invitel Távközlési Zrt (formerly, “Invitel Távközlési Szolgáltató Zrt”), a company constituted under Hungarian Law, registered under firm no. Cg. 13-10-040575, with its seat in Budaörs and business address at Puskás Tivadar u. 8-10., 2040 Budaörs, Hungary (“Invitel”);

 

(3) Memorex Telex Communications AG, a stock corporation under Austrian law, registered with the commercial register of the Regional Court of Wiener Neustadt under the firm no. FN 99090 x (the “Target Company”); and

 

(4)                     

(each a “Party” and collectively the “Parties”).

WHEREAS:

 

A. JOKI and Invitel entered into a Share Purchase Agreement dated 20 December 2007 regarding the purchase of 95.7% of the outstanding equity shares of the Target Company, as amended by the Amendment Agreement dated 29 February 2008 (the “Agreement”), and the transactions contemplated by the Agreement were completed on 5 March 2008;

 

B. JOKI, Invitel and              (the “Escrow Agent”) entered into a Holdback Escrow Agreement dated 3 March 2008 (the “Escrow Agreement”);

 

C.              and Invitel entered into a Consultancy Agreement dated 20 December 2007 pursuant to which              was to provide certain consultancy services to Invitel (the “Consultancy Agreement”);

 

D. Various disputes (the “Disputes”) have arisen amongst Invitel, JOKI and              in connection with the Agreement;

 

E. The Disputes have been the subject of correspondence including             ...;

 

F. On behalf of Invitel on 5 June 2008 Réczicza White & Case LLP sent a letter to              which letter constituted a Claim Notice by Invitel under the Escrow Agreement;


G. On 5 June 2008, Invitel terminated the Consultancy Agreement with immediate effect in accordance with the terms of the Consultancy Agreement (the “Termination Notice”); and

 

H. The Parties now wish to reach a full and final settlement of all actual and potential claims arising out of or in connection with the Agreement and/or the Consultancy Agreement, including, without limitation, the Disputes.

NOW, THEREFORE, in consideration of the payments specified and the mutual promises, covenants and releases contained herein, the Parties agree as follows:

 

1. JOKI and Invitel shall on the date of execution of this Settlement Agreement sign and deliver to the Escrow Agent an Agreed Claim Certificate (as set out in Schedule 5.2.1(i) to the Escrow Agreement) in the form of Schedule 1 to this Settlement Agreement (the “Agreed Claim Certificate”) providing that (i) the amount of €11,250,000 (the “Settlement Sum”) shall be immediately released to Invitel by the Escrow Agent and (ii) the remaining escrow sum of €870,240 together with any interest accrued with respect to the Escrow Amount (as defined in the Escrow Agreement) (the “Escrow Balance”) shall be immediately released to JOKI by the Escrow Agent. The Agreed Claim Certificate shall also provide that upon the payment of the Settlement Sum to Invitel and the Escrow Balance to JOKI, the Escrow Agreement will be terminated.

16. This Settlement Agreement shall be governed by, and construed in accordance with, English law (excluding the application of English conflict of laws principles).

 

17. All disputes arising out of or in connection with this Settlement Agreement shall be finally settled in Geneva, Switzerland under the rules of conciliation and arbitration of the International Chamber of Commerce (ICC) in the English language by three (3) arbitrators appointed in accordance with said rules.

All reasonable attorney’s fees and costs incurred by the prevailing party in any arbitration pursuant to this Settlement Agreement, and the cost of such arbitration, shall be paid by the other party to the arbitration within five (5) days after receipt of written demand from the prevailing party following the rendition of the written decision of the arbitration tribunal, or as otherwise ordered by the arbitration tribunal. On the application of such prevailing party before or after the initial decision of the arbitration tribunal, and proof of its attorneys’ fees and costs, the arbitration tribunal shall order the other party to the arbitration to make the payments provided for in the preceding sentence.

Any decision rendered by any arbitration tribunal pursuant to this clause shall be final and binding on the parties thereto, and judgment thereon may be entered by any court of competent jurisdiction. The Parties specifically agree that any arbitration tribunal shall be empowered to award and order equitable or injunctive relief with respect to matters brought before it.

Arbitration shall be the exclusive method available for resolution of claims, disputes and controversies described in this clause, and the Parties stipulate that the provisions hereof shall be a complete defence to any suit, action, or proceeding in any court or before any administrative or arbitration tribunal with respect to any such claim, controversy or dispute, other than any proceeding in any court for the enforcement of an arbitral award rendered in accordance with this clause 17. The provisions of this clause shall survive the termination or expiration of this Settlement Agreement.

Notwithstanding the terms of this clause or any contrary provisions in the ICC rules, at any time before and after a demand for arbitration is presented, the Parties shall be free to apply to any court of competent jurisdiction for interim or conservatory measures (including temporary conservatory injunctions). The Parties acknowledge and agree that any such action by a party shall not be deemed to be a breach of such party’s obligation to arbitrate all disputes under this clause or infringe upon the powers of any arbitral panel.
